CCC Members Meeting on “CSO Accountability in the Context of Post LANGO and SDGs”

06 October 2015, Diakonia Center : Around 100 participants from 80 CSOs representative joined 4th CCC’s Bi-monthly meeting. This platform is a great opportunity for members to meet various experts on Accountability of CSOs and SDGs from national and global levels as panelist to share and debate on CSO Accountability in the context of SDGs and LANGO. Objectives of the Forum:

  • To celebrate new members and new accreditation of CCC as a role model organization with good governance and professional practices.
  • To discuss and debate on CSO Accountability in the context of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and LANGOs
  • To discuss on implications and strategies to mitigate any impacts from LANGO
  • To share result of membership satisfactory survey conducted during CCC AGM 2015 and conduct a new survey and need assessment for 2016.
  • To present his study on “Localization and Financing for Sustainable Development Goals”and summary of the UN General Assembly on approval to the SDGs 2016-2030.

LANGO : INGOs issued letter withdraw the draft LANGO

26 Jun 2015 Phnom Penh

PHNOM PENH (26 June 2015) - With a small chance to consult over the concerns of current draft LANGO (#stopandconsult), more than 30 International Network Organizations jointly issued the letter to Samdech Heng Samrin, President of the National Assembly to withdraw draft of LANGO.

International Delegation Tours Cambodia to Promote Civic Space

07 Oct 2014 Phnom Penh

Phnom Penh (October 7, 2014) – International delegates from seven global civil society networks have arrived in Cambodia to meet with local non-profit organizations, international development partners and the government to discuss growing restrictions on civil society activities in the country.
